What Are Aluminum Extrusion Profiles?
Simply put, aluminum extrusion profiles are shapes made from aluminum that are created by forcing the metal through a specific die. This process allows for the creation of a variety of shapes and sizes while maintaining a lightweight structure. Isn't that cool? The versatility of these profiles makes them perfect for everything from window frames to intricate machinery parts.
The Extrusion Process: How It Works
Alright, here's where it gets interesting! The extrusion process involves heating aluminum to a malleable state and then pushing it through a die. This method ensures that the final product retains its structural integrity while being shaped into the desired profile. And guess what? This process can also be done with various alloys, providing even more options for engineers and designers alike.
Benefits of Using Aluminum Extrusion Profiles
- Lightweight yet strong, making them ideal for construction.
- Corrosion-resistant, ensuring longevity in various environments.
- Highly customizable, allowing for unique designs tailored to specific needs.
- Eco-friendly, as aluminum can be recycled without losing its quality.
Applications Across Industries
From the moment you wake up and open your beautifully designed window to the car you drive, aluminum extrusion profiles are everywhere! Here are some common applications:
- Construction: Used in window frames, doors, and structural components.
- Automotive: Lightweight parts that enhance fuel efficiency and performance.
- Electronics: Housing for devices that require heat dissipation.
- Furniture: Sleek designs that combine aesthetics with functionality.
